Smart Strategies for First-Time Homebuyers
Navigating the housing market for the first time can feel overwhelming. Yet, with a bit of planning and these effective strategies, you can make your homeownership aspirations a reality.
First, define your budget carefully. Get click here pre-qualified for a mortgage to understand how much you can borrow. Remember to factor in costs like property taxes, insurance, and potential repairs.
Next, explore different neighborhoods that suit your lifestyle and needs. Visit open houses to get a feel for the styles of homes available in your budget limit.
Working with an experienced real estate advisor can be beneficial. They can provide market insights throughout the process, from negotiating offers to completing the transaction.
Finally, hesitate to ask questions and meticulously review all contracts before signing anything. With these effective strategies, you can successfully navigate the home buying process and achieve your dream of homeownership.

The Power of Location in Real Estate
Location is a crucial factor to real estate. The attractiveness of an area can drastically influence the value and popularity of properties. Investors often prioritize factors such as proximity to facilities, schools, commuting routes, and well-maintained neighborhoods when making a decision. A property's location can significantly impact its overall success in the market.
Considerations like neighborhood atmosphere, local culture, and future development plans can all contribute to a location's value.
